Abstract

This article presents a solution to the problem of the conditions of nonregular precession of a rigid body in three homogeneous fields, in which the ratio of precession and proper rotation velocities is constant. It is shown that the precession of a dynamically symmetric body is possible at a precession velocity equal to, twice as large as, or twice as small as the proper rotation velocity. For each of the cases, the set of admissible positions of the centres of the forces and the relation between the body moments of inertia and constant nutation angle are given.
